Summary: This work is devoted to the model building, verification of QSAR models and analysis on their basis of the structural factors of molecules that determine their ability to penetrate the blood-brain barrier (BBB). Based on literature analysis and other sources, the database was formed and verified with BBB penetration indicators known for organic compounds. A number of adequate QSAR models have been developed to assess the parameters of the penetration of substances through the BBB — LogBB, LogPS, LogP0PAMPA-BBB, belonging to the BBB+ / BBB- class, P-glycoprotein substrate / non-substrate. Robustness (stability) and predictive ability were evaluated for all models. Physicochemical and structural interpretations of the developed QSAR models were carried out.
